Just bought my first DSM and am planning on learning as much as possible about these cars. We bought a 1g 1990 Eagle talon tsi awd and am wondering, would springs and shocks from a 1990 FWD talon fit on a 90 AWD talon?
 
Front shocks and springs will work (They are the same 90 94 T/E/L AWD and FWD, 5 speed/Auto). Rear will bolt up, but don't do it. If you do, don't say we didn't warn you not to. I'm at work, and don't recall off the top of my head right now, but the FWD and AWD REAR ONLY shocks and springs are different rates and lengths. They will bolt up, but if you wreck your car, don't point your finger...
 
1g Rear FWD shocks are too short to fit the rear of the AWD. You can change the rear springs. But the AWD weigh more on the rear so the car will sag and not handle right.
 
Thanks for your reply. I found a full BRAND NEW set for a FWD at ($180) and was planning on just doing the fronts due to a VERY harsh ride. The rears seem to be ok. Just wanted to make sure they would fit (at least on the front)
